在计算机网络中,IP地址是用于标识设备在网络中的唯一身份。根据IP地址的结构和用途,IPv4地址被划分为不同的类别,其中最常见的就是A类、B类和C类地址。这些分类不仅决定了地址的分配方式,还影响了子网划分和网络设计。
一、A类IP地址
A类IP地址主要用于大型网络,其特点是网络号部分较短,主机号部分较长。A类地址的首位二进制位为“0”,因此其取值范围为 1.0.0.0 到 126.255.255.255。
- 默认子网掩码:255.0.0.0
- 网络位数:8位(前8位表示网络号)
- 主机位数:24位(后24位表示主机号)
A类地址的总数约为 126个网络,每个网络可容纳约 16,777,214台主机,适用于大规模企业或机构使用。
二、B类IP地址
B类IP地址适用于中型网络,其前两位二进制位为“10”,因此其取值范围为 128.0.0.0 到 191.255.255.255。
- 默认子网掩码:255.255.0.0
- 网络位数:16位(前16位表示网络号)
- 主机位数:16位(后16位表示主机号)
B类地址共有 16,384个网络,每个网络最多支持 65,534台主机,适合中等规模的组织或公司使用。
三、C类IP地址
C类IP地址主要用于小型网络,其前三位二进制位为“110”,因此其取值范围为 192.0.0.0 到 223.255.255.255。
- 默认子网掩码:255.255.255.0
- 网络位数:24位(前24位表示网络号)
- 主机位数:8位(后8位表示主机号)
C类地址共有 2,097,152个网络,每个网络最多支持 254台主机,常用于家庭网络、小型办公室等场景。
四、总结
| 类别 | 地址范围 | 默认子网掩码 | 网络位数 | 主机位数 |
|------|--------------------|------------------|----------|----------|
| A类| 1.0.0.0 – 126.255.255.255 | 255.0.0.0| 8位| 24位 |
| B类| 128.0.0.0 – 191.255.255.255 | 255.255.0.0| 16位 | 16位 |
| C类| 192.0.0.0 – 223.255.255.255 | 255.255.255.0| 24位 | 8位|
了解不同类别的IP地址及其默认子网掩码,有助于合理规划网络结构,提高网络效率,并避免IP地址的浪费。随着IPv4地址资源的逐渐耗尽,现代网络更多地采用子网划分、VLSM(可变长度子网掩码)以及IPv6技术来满足日益增长的网络需求。